WebDec 1, 2024 · Psychosocial support interventions are interpersonal or informational activities, strategies or techniques that can target biological, behavioural, cognitive, emotional, interpersonal, social or environmental factors with the aim of improving an individual’s health functioning and mental well-being [ 18 ]. WebJan 11, 2024 · Psychosocial interventions are commonly used for issues of social disorders, substance abuse cessation, and prevention of relapse.

WebMar 2, 2024 · Developmental psychology is the branch of psychology that focuses on how people grow and change over the course of a lifetime. Those who specialize in this field are not just concerned with the physical changes that occur as people grow; they also look at the social, emotional, and cognitive development that occurs throughout life.
